Rachel Crew - 02 Aug 2006 09:07 GMT
Hi Doug

yes I have updated the fields (CTRL+A, then F9) and have checked that Tools,
Options and picture placeholders is off (I can see normal pictures OK) the
placeholders just show a box and a red cross in the top left corner.  This
happens on someone elses PC too.....

Peter Jamieson - 02 Aug 2006 09:53 GMT
You should also try adding a \d switch at the end of the INCLUDEPICTURE
field if there isn't one already
